DAAD
The German Academic Exchange Service (DAAD) awards annual scholarships for stays abroad of 8 to 12 months to students of all subjects. You have to find a place to study abroad yourself.

Study abroad grant
As a rule, students can receive educational support for one year when studying abroad. You are entitled to funding if
- the education abroad is conducive to the level of education (basic knowledge from at least one year of study in Germany),
- sufficient knowledge of the language of the country and the language of instruction can be demonstrated and
- the stay abroad lasts at least six months or, in the case of university cooperation and internships, at least three months.
As the financial requirements for a stay abroad can be higher (travel costs, tuition fees, foreign supplement) than for studying in Germany, students who are not entitled to BAf?G for their studies in Germany may also be entitled to BAf?G abroad. Questions and answers on funding abroad can be found on the BAf?G pages of the Federal Ministry of Education and Research.
You should apply for funding abroad at least six months before the start of your trip at the relevant education funding office. The addresses of the relevant international offices can also be found on the above-mentioned pages.
Educational loan
Support through an education loan is independent of the assets and income of the applicant and their parents. A loan application must be submitted to the Federal Office of Administration.
